Senior Accountant

4 months ago


Williston, United States LendingTree Full time

*PLEASE NOTE: The Senior Accountant will be required to be located in Charlotte, NC and come into the office Tuesday-Thursday.* The Position: Supports all month end close activities Transact weekly/monthly billing, including invoice preparation and all billing related journal entries. Prepares and records assigned expense categories via creation of purchase orders and journal entries. Performs analysis related to customer invoicing questions. Prepares assigned journal entries. Ensures GAAP compliance in revenue recognition, specifically application of ASC 606. Performs assigned GL account reconciliations and monthly variance analysis. Prepares management reporting. Accounting system/process Accountable for daily processes relating to revenue, credit and accounting Provides functional and technical analysis and support of the financial systems environment, including Workday accounting and internal revenue database systems. Performs routine reconciliations between systems to ensure data integrity. Identifies issues and works with resources across business and technical departments to identify root causes. Ensures business requirements are met and required testing and sign-offs are obtained prior to implementation in production. Assists in accounting system maintenance and process improvements. Assists in automation projects related to revenue and expense. Troubleshoots technology issues and coordinate with appropriate staff. Accounts Receivable Analyze and input journal entries pertaining to accounts receivable and customer cash. Investigate discrepancies related to customer account receivable balances. Perform reconciliations to assist with customer cash applications. Other duties Assist management in new business projects/processes. Assist in any assigned accounting related projects. Provide support for subsidiary personnel. Assist in audits as needed. Any other duties assigned by management. Experience / Training / Education: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ance or related field. Prior relevant 3-4 years experience Knowledge / Skills / Abilities: Computer skills: MS Word, intermediate to advanced MS Excel, intermediate to advanced MS Outlook, intermediate knowledge of Internet. Experience with system and manually generated billing. Thorough working knowledge of revenue recognition and invoicing with significant understanding of General Ledger impact. Demonstrated understanding of how accounting systems function and process data. Ability to research and analyze various types of data Ability to work with large amounts of data. Effective oral and written communication skills. Excellent interpersonal skills. Ability to work under pressure of multiple projects and deadlines. Ability to effectively prioritize workload and manage changes in direction. Ability to interpret and apply required policies and procedures. Ability to work in a team environment. Strong organizational skills and attention to detail are essential for success in this position. COMPANY LendingTree is the nation’s largest online lending marketplace. That means we connect customers with multiple lenders, so they find the best deals on loans, credit cards, savings accounts and insurance. Our goal is to help people save money, and we believe the best way to do that is by giving them a way to shop for loans and compare lenders, so they make their best financial choices. Our CEO Doug Lebda founded the company in 1996 after a frustrating house-hunting experience. In those days, we mostly helped people find good mortgage deals. Now, we help consumers find their best in personal loans, auto loans, business loans, student loans, credit cards, savings accounts, home equity loans and more. What else you should know: We’re a publicly-traded company (TREE). We’ve welcomed several other companies into the LendingTree family to augment our efforts at helping borrowers make their most sensible financial choices.
